Ride in Style: The Pink Pony Express on the KC Streetcar Line

The latest addition to the KC Streetcar line is the Pink Pony Express, a unique wrap featuring Midwest Princess Chappell Roan. Her team chose the streetcar as a platform to promote her upcoming pop-up shows at the National World War I Museum and Memorial on Oct. 3-4. The Pink Pony Express is a nod to Roan's hit song "Pink Pony Club" and the Pony Express from St. Joseph, blending her persona with regional history.

The Pink Pony Express will debut on Sept. 26, a week before Roan's performances, allowing riders to get excited for the shows. The streetcar is wrapped in baby pink and sky blue on the outside, while the interior features additional design elements by Roan's team and the streetcar staff. Expect pink disco balls, artwork, and possibly pink lighting inside to set the mood for the upcoming shows.
